About the role
This is an exciting time to join Procurement at the Society! We are part of a recently formed Risk and Compliance team, supporting one of the fastest growing large charities in the country.
This role will provide backfill support to the team resulting from a secondment to a project to implement a new finance system for the Society which includes purchase to pay functionality.
The role will primarily support our Information Technology and Data teams and wider Directorates across the Society where the purchase of software systems or IT solutions are required.
Support will also be required with the new finance system project.
In addition, you will work alongside the Senior Procurement Manager to develop and embed the policies and procedures that will ensure that every pound we raise is spent effectively.
About you
Experience of supporting categories in IT systems, hardware, licenses, and professional services.
Experience in developing and testing integrated finance and purchase to pay systems.
Provide advice on best practice contract management techniques as well as SLA and KPI design and measurement.
While responsibility for contract and supplier management will remain with the business areas, you will also build strong relationships with strategic suppliers.
